Output 64c59b2b481fc4d561af239d8c27576238e24f75a531e49b77bd4662188032da:0

value
290216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857706fb662f2b3349afede892279d347bc8ef3c OP_EQUAL
address
3DriPDYkUo1UsB3Tsnhp6YwTssAPhCiVbW
transaction
64c59b2b481fc4d561af239d8c27576238e24f75a531e49b77bd4662188032da